Description

Position Overview: We are currently se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Press Brake Operator to join our team. The Fabrication Machine Operator will play a critical role in our production process, responsible for operating and maintaining various fabrication machines to ensure the efficient and accurate manufacturing of parts and components.

Responsibilities:

  1. Machine Setup: Set up and prepare fabrication machines for operation, including loading materials, adjusting settings, and selecting appropriate tools and programs.
  2. Machine Operation: Operate fabrication machines such as CNC routers, laser cutters, press brakes, or shears to cut, shape, bend, or otherwise process materials according to engineering drawings, blueprints, or work orders.
  3. Quality Control: Monitor production output to ensure that parts meet quality standards and specifications, conducting visual inspections and using precision measuring instruments as necessary.
  4. Material Handling: Load and unload materials onto fabrication machines safely and efficiently, using appropriate equipment and techniques.
  5. Maintenance and Troubleshooting: Perform routine maintenance on fabrication machines, including cleaning, lubricating, and performing minor repairs as needed. Troubleshoot machine malfunctions and make adjustments to ensure optimal performance.
  6. Documentation: Maintain accurate production records, including job setup sheets, production logs, and quality inspection reports.
  7. Safety Compliance: Adhere to all safety protocols and guidelines to ensure a safe working environment for yourself and your colleagues.

Qualifications


  • Write basic bend programs in a machine.
  • Bend basic parts 90-degree bends / 8 bend panels.
  • What dyes to use on what materials when forming
  • Knowledge of fractions and decimals.
  • Knowledge of different types of material thicknesses.
  • Knowledge of how to properly read a tape measure.
  • Knowledge of different bend allowances that are shown on prints.
